**Mgmt Meeting Minutes — Retiring the Brightline Range**

Quick recap for sales leads at Fenholt Supplies: we agreed to retire the Brightline fixture range by year-end. Remaining stock moves to clearance pricing next month, and accounts on standing orders get migrated to the Lumetta range. Trade-in incentives were approved in principle. The confidential note on next steps sits just below.

board note of bajof-bajeg: The pricing group signed off on a budget of $13.4 million for Project Sildor. The renewal with Lamixek Holdings closes at $48.9 million a year, 49 percent above the last contract.

Ticket: Enable SQL lint gate on release branch

Proposal: enforce sqlcheck ruleset v3 on all .sql files in Quartzline before cut. Blocks merges on uppercase keyword violations, missing semicolons, unqualified SELECT *. Legacy migrations exempted via allowlist. CI job tested on staging; adds ~40s to pipeline. Risk: low. Rollback: disable the gate flag. Needs release-manager sign-off before Friday's freeze. Approver is named below.

signatory, yagap-bawig: Ulaath Eliath

- [ ] **Step 7: Breaker override escrow.** After sealing the signing keys for the Tallgrove upstream API circuit breaker, confirm the support team can force the breaker open during a full outage. The override bundle lives in the sealed escrow drawer and is useless without its unlock phrase. Two ceremony witnesses must initial this step before proceeding. The escrow bundle is decrypted with the recovery passphrase that follows.

vault phrase of kahip-kahop = holath-quenmir